At your procedure visit, a technician will perform a transvaginal ultrasound. You will discuss your decision and options with a counselor and talk more about the procedure, side effects, and risks outlined in the Guide.
Assistant will take your vital signs (blood pressure, heart rate, and temperature) and you will meet with a physician. The physician will ask you about your decision and answer any questions you may have. The physician will then give you one 1st that you will take orally. If your blood type is Rh negative, a nurse will administer an injection of Rhogam in the recovery room. Bleeding & Cramping. Most people can expect very heavy bleeding with this method and it is normal to pass some large clots. Bleeding may continue off and on for several days or weeks and can range from a light flow or spotting to heavier, like a period. However, if you do not begin bleeding within 24 hours or you are soaking through 2 or more pads per hour for 2 hours in a row, please call AWC immediately. Cramping is normal with this type of procedure and may be much worse than a period. Pain measures will be prescribed.

Call our office immediately if, more than 24 hours after taking them, you experience symptoms of nausea, vomiting, or diarrhea and weakness with or without abdominal pain, or with or without fever. A temperature of 101° F or higher can be normal after taking . Your temperature should return to normal about one hour after the bleeding starts. Drink lots of fluids. If your fever does not return to normal in three hours call the clinic. If you get a fever above 100.4° F after day 4, please call our office immediately.
Follow-up Visit. Approximately 7-10 days after your first visit you will return to AWC for a repeat vaginal ultrasound. Approximately 1% of people using the abortion pill method will not end their pregnancies and 2-3% will have remaining pregnancy tissue in the uterus at the time of the follow-up appointment. If the abortion is complete, you will discuss and future care. If you are still pregnant, you will most likely need surgery to complete the abortion.
Post bleeding and cramping varies from person to person. You may bleed for two days to 4 weeks or have no bleeding at all. For many people, the bleeding stops and starts sporadically. There may be spotting until your next period. You may also find that you are passing large blood clots and have mild to moderate or even heavy cramping. All of this can be normal.
